




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
區塊鏈技術信任協作框架設計區塊鏈技術信任協作框架設計區塊鏈技術信任協作框架設計四、信任協作框架的關鍵技術實現4.1分布式賬本技術分布式賬本是區塊鏈技術的核心基礎,其實現依賴于分布式數據庫技術和密碼學哈希算法。在區塊鏈網絡中,每個節點都維護著一份完整或部分的賬本副本,這些副本通過網絡同步保持一致性。賬本中的每一筆交易都經過加密處理,并以哈希值的形式鏈接到前一個交易,形成一個不可篡改的鏈式結構。為了確保分布式賬本的一致性和可靠性,采用了多種技術手段。例如,拜占庭容錯(BFT)算法可以在存在惡意節點的情況下,保證節點之間達成一致的決策。在實際應用中,如聯盟鏈場景下,實用拜占庭容錯(PBFT)算法被廣泛使用。它通過多輪消息交互,使節點能夠對交易進行驗證和確認,最終達成一致的賬本狀態。4.2加密算法應用加密算法在區塊鏈技術信任協作框架中起著至關重要的作用,主要用于保護數據的機密性、完整性和認證性。非對稱加密算法,如RSA和橢圓曲線密碼體制(ECC),用于生成公鑰和私鑰對。公鑰可以公開,用于加密數據或驗證數字簽名,私鑰則由用戶保密,用于解密數據或生成數字簽名。在交易過程中,發送方使用接收方的公鑰對交易信息進行加密,確保只有接收方能夠使用私鑰解密并查看交易內容。同時,數字簽名技術利用私鑰對交易進行簽名,接收方可以使用發送方的公鑰驗證簽名的有效性,從而確保交易的完整性和不可抵賴性。對于數據存儲在區塊鏈上的安全性,采用哈希算法對數據進行哈希運算,生成固定長度的哈希值。任何對數據的微小修改都會導致哈希值的巨大變化,因此可以通過比較哈希值來檢測數據是否被篡改。例如,在區塊鏈的區塊頭中存儲前一區塊數據的哈希值,這樣就形成了一個鏈式結構,保證了數據的完整性和不可篡改性。4.3共識機制優化共識機制是區塊鏈網絡中節點就交易有效性和賬本狀態達成一致的關鍵。除了常見的工作量證明(PoW)和權益證明(PoS)共識機制外,還有一些改進和優化的共識算法被提出。委托權益證明(DPoS)機制通過選舉代表節點來驗證交易和生成區塊,大大提高了交易處理速度。這些代表節點由持幣者投票選出,代表他們的利益參與區塊鏈的維護。DPoS機制在一定程度上減少了能源消耗,同時保持了區塊鏈的去中心化特性。瑞波共識協議(RCP)則適用于特定的聯盟鏈場景,它基于信任列表中的節點進行共識。節點之間通過特定的通信協議和投票機制來達成一致,這種機制可以快速確認交易,適用于需要高效處理大量交易的金融場景。在實際應用中,根據不同的業務需求和網絡環境選擇合適的共識機制至關重要。例如,在對安全性要求極高且去中心化程度要求高的數字貨幣領域,PoW可能仍然是一種可行的選擇;而在企業級聯盟鏈應用中,DPoS或其他高效的共識機制可能更適合,以滿足快速交易處理和低延遲的要求。4.4智能合約開發與部署智能合約是區塊鏈技術實現自動化信任協作的關鍵工具。智能合約采用特定的編程語言編寫,如以太坊的Solidity語言。在開發智能合約時,需要明確合約的業務邏輯和規則,包括交易條件、數據驗證、狀態轉換等。智能合約的部署過程涉及將編寫好的合約代碼編譯成字節碼,并通過交易的方式部署到區塊鏈網絡上。一旦部署成功,智能合約就成為區塊鏈的一部分,其執行過程是完全自動化且透明的。合約的執行結果將影響區塊鏈上的數據狀態,并且所有節點都能夠驗證合約的執行過程和結果。為了確保智能合約的安全性和正確性,需要進行嚴格的代碼審查和測試。形式化驗證方法可以用于證明智能合約的邏輯正確性,避免潛在的漏洞和安全風險。同時,在合約運行過程中,還需要建立有效的監控和管理機制,以便及時發現和處理合約執行中的異常情況。五、信任協作框架的測試與評估5.1測試方法與工具為了確保區塊鏈技術信任協作框架的可靠性和性能,需要進行全面的測試。功能測試用于驗證框架的各個功能模塊是否按照設計要求正常工作,包括身份認證、數據存儲與共享、智能合約執行等功能。使用自動化測試工具,如Selenium和JUnit等,編寫測試用例來模擬各種業務場景下的操作,檢查系統的輸出是否符合預期。性能測試主要關注框架在不同負載條件下的表現。通過壓力測試工具,如JMeter和LoadRunner等,模擬大量并發用戶和交易請求,測量系統的響應時間、吞吐量、交易處理速度等性能指標。在性能測試過程中,逐步增加負載強度,觀察系統的性能變化,確定系統的瓶頸所在,為性能優化提供依據。安全測試是確保區塊鏈框架安全的關鍵環節。采用漏洞掃描工具,如Nessus和OpenVAS等,檢測系統中可能存在的安全漏洞,包括網絡漏洞、加密算法漏洞、智能合約漏洞等。同時,進行滲透測試,模擬黑客攻擊行為,嘗試突破系統的安全防線,評估系統在面對實際安全威脅時的防御能力。5.2評估指標體系建立一個全面的評估指標體系對于衡量區塊鏈技術信任協作框架的有效性至關重要。可靠性指標包括系統的穩定性、數據的完整性和一致性。通過長時間運行測試,觀察系統是否出現故障或數據錯誤,計算系統的平均故障間隔時間(MTBF)和平均修復時間(MTTR)等指標來評估系統的可靠性。性能指標如交易處理能力、響應時間和吞吐量等直接影響用戶體驗和系統的實用性。交易處理能力可以用每秒處理的交易數量(TPS)來衡量,響應時間是指從交易提交到收到響應的時間間隔,吞吐量則表示系統在單位時間內能夠處理的數據量。安全性指標評估系統抵御各種安全威脅的能力。包括加密算法的強度、訪問控制的有效性、漏洞數量和嚴重程度等。通過安全評估工具和實際攻擊測試,評估系統在數據保密性、完整性和可用性方面的保障程度。信任度指標則關注框架在建立和維護參與方之間信任關系方面的效果。可以通過監測節點的行為、信任評分的分布以及協作成功率等指標來評估信任模型的有效性和整個框架的信任水平。5.3測試結果分析與優化根據測試結果,對區塊鏈技術信任協作框架進行深入分析,找出存在的問題和不足之處。如果在功能測試中發現某些功能不符合預期,需要仔細檢查代碼邏輯和業務規則實現,及時修復漏洞和錯誤。對于性能瓶頸問題,如在高負載下響應時間過長或吞吐量下降,需要針對性地進行優化。可能涉及到對區塊鏈網絡配置的調整、共識機制的優化、智能合約代碼的優化以及數據存儲方式的改進等方面。例如,通過增加節點數量、優化網絡拓撲結構來提高網絡的并行處理能力;對智能合約進行代碼優化,減少不必要的計算和存儲操作,提高合約執行效率。在安全測試中發現的漏洞和風險必須及時處理。根據漏洞的嚴重程度和影響范圍,采取相應的修復措施,如更新加密算法、加強訪問控制、修復智能合約漏洞等。同時,持續關注安全領域的最新動態,及時更新安全防護策略,確保系統的安全性。根據測試結果和分析,不斷優化信任協作框架,提高其性能、可靠性和安全性,以滿足實際業務應用的需求。通過迭代式的測試和優化過程,使區塊鏈技術信任協作框架逐步成熟和完善。六、信任協作框架的應用前景與挑戰6.1潛在應用領域拓展隨著區塊鏈技術的不斷發展,其信任協作框架在更多領域展現出廣闊的應用前景。在金融領域,除了供應鏈金融和跨境支付外,區塊鏈技術可用于證券交易、保險理賠等環節,提高交易的透明度和效率,降低中間成本。例如,通過區塊鏈實現證券的發行、交易和結算一體化,減少傳統證券交易中的繁瑣流程和中介機構的參與,提高市場的流動性和穩定性。在政務服務方面,區塊鏈技術可以用于構建可信的政務數據共享平臺,實現政府部門之間的數據互聯互通和信息共享,提高政務服務的協同性和便捷性。公民的身份信息、社保記錄、房產信息等可以安全地存儲在區塊鏈上,方便政府部門在辦理各類業務時進行快速驗證和審批,同時也保障了公民數據的隱私和安全。在文化創意產業中,區塊鏈技術可以用于數字版權保護。創作者可以將作品的版權信息上鏈,通過智能合約實現版權的授權和交易管理,確保創作者的權益得到有效保護,同時也方便版權的追溯和維權。此外,區塊鏈技術還可以應用于能源交易、公益慈善等領域,為這些領域帶來新的信任協作模式和創新解決方案。6.2面臨的挑戰與應對策略盡管區塊鏈技術信任協作框架具有巨大的潛力,但在實際應用中仍面臨一些挑戰。性能和可擴展性仍然是一個關鍵問題,隨著區塊鏈網絡規模的擴大和交易數量的增加,現有的區塊鏈技術在處理速度和存儲容量方面可能面臨瓶頸。為了解決這一問題,需要持續研究和開發新的技術,如分片技術、側鏈技術等,提高區塊鏈的并行處理能力和擴展性。法律法規的不完善也是制約區塊鏈發展的重要因素。區塊鏈技術的去中心化和匿名性特點給監管帶來了一定難度,目前在數據隱私保護、智能合約法律地位、稅收政策等方面還缺乏明確的法律法規規范。政府和監管機構需要加強研究,制定適應區塊鏈技術特點的法律法規,既保障創新發展,又維護社會公平和安全。標準不統一也是區塊鏈行業面臨的挑戰之一。不同的區塊鏈平臺和應用在技術架構、數據格式、接口規范等方面存在差異,導致互操作性差,限制了區塊鏈技術的大規模應用和跨平臺協作。行業協會和標準化組織應積極推動區塊鏈技術標準的制定,促進不同平臺之間的兼容和互操作。公眾認知和接受度也是一個需要克服的障礙。由于區塊鏈技術相對較新,公眾對其了解有限,存在一些誤解和擔憂,如對加密貨幣的風險認知、對數據隱私的擔憂等。需要加強區塊鏈技術的科普宣傳和教育,提高公眾對區塊鏈技術的認知和信任,促進其在更廣泛領域的應用和推廣。總結區塊鏈技術信任協作框架為構建可信、高效的協作環境提供了一種創新的解決方案。通過分布式賬本、加密算法、共識機制和智能合約等核心技術,實現了數據的安全存儲、交易的可信執行和參與方之間的自動化協作。在架構設計方面,從整體架構、模塊功能、信任模型、接口設計到性能優化、安全性增強、部署運維等環節進行了詳細規劃,確保框架能夠滿足不同應用場景的需求。在關鍵技術實現過程中,不斷優化分布式賬本、加密算法、共識機制和智能合約等技術,提高框架的性能和安全性。通過全面的測試與評估,發現并解決框架存在的問題,持續
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 中外樂器試題及答案大全
- 益陽市重點中學2025屆高二化學第二學期期末監測模擬試題含解析
- 浙江省杭州地區2024-2025學年高二下物理期末學業質量監測試題含解析
- 高效車庫租賃合同范本:涵蓋車位租賃與增值服務
- 茶具行業展會舉辦與贊助合同
- 雞類產品養殖基地與包裝企業采購合同
- 金融服務代理授權委托合同樣本
- 讀一本書的心得體會(32篇)
- 天津市老年城建設項目可行性研究報告
- 2024年高郵市衛健系統事業單位招聘專業技術人員筆試真題
- 電競店加盟合同協議書
- 2025中國甲烷大會:2024-2025全球甲烷控排進展報告
- 術后急性疼痛及個體化鎮痛
- 2024年公安機關理論考試題庫500道附參考答案【基礎題】
- 血管內導管相關性血流感染預防與診治指南(2025)解讀
- GB/T 196-2025普通螺紋基本尺寸
- 2025年湖南省長沙市語文中考作文趨勢預測(基于近十年分析)
- 2025至2030中國PDH裝置市場深度調查與競爭格局研究報告
- 集團統借統還管理制度
- 酒店二次供水管理制度
- 瀝青攪拌站原材料采購管理流程
評論
0/150
提交評論